House window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, modern units that better suit the home's needs. This process typically includes measuring the opening, selecting the appropriate window style, and carefully installing the new window to ensure proper fit and function. Professional contractors often handle all aspects of the replacement, including removing old frames, preparing the opening, and sealing the new window to prevent drafts and leaks. This service can improve the overall appearance of a home while also enhancing energy efficiency and indoor comfort.
Window replacement can help address several common problems faced by homeowners. Over time, windows may become drafty, difficult to open or close, or damaged by weather and age. Cracked or broken glass can compromise security and insulation, leading to higher energy bills. Additionally, outdated windows might not match the home's current style or may lack features like better insulation or soundproofing. Replacing worn or damaged windows can resolve these issues, making a home more comfortable, secure, and visually appealing.

Homeowners considering window replacement typically do so when experiencing specific issues or planning upgrades. Common signs include difficulty operating windows, noticeable drafts, condensation between panes, or visible damage like cracks or rotting wood. Some may also choose replacement to update the style or improve energy efficiency, especially if their current windows are outdated or no longer meet their needs. The overview below groups typical House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bolivar,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for small window repairs or replacements in Bolivar, MO range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for standard-sized windows that require minimal work.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um, which usually involves additional materials or specialized repairs.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ing a standard residential window often costs between $500 and $1,200. Local contractors frequently perform jobs in this middle range, balancing quality and affordability for most homeowners. Larger or more complex replacements can push costs toward $2,000 or more.
Full Window Replacement Projects - Complete replacement of multiple windows or larger units can typically range from $2,000 to $5,000+. Many projects in this category are for standard homes, but larger, more intricate projects may exceed this range depending on window types and installation complexity.
High-End or Custom Installations - Custom, energy-efficient, or specialty windows in Bolivar, MO can cost $5,000 and above. These projects are less common and usually involve premium materials or unique designs, which significantly increase the overall cost.
